Hotel Overview – The Grand Dame of the Far East
For almost a century, The Peninsula Hong Kong has stood as a landmark of grandeur and grace. Built by The Hongkong and Shanghai Hotels, it was envisioned as the finest hotel east of Suez and has since become a benchmark for excellence. Its façade reflects the city’s layered identity — an architectural dialogue between colonial elegance and modern ambition.
Located on Salisbury Road in Kowloon, the property merges historical design with innovation. The original Edwardian and Italianate structure, with its stately columns and intricate detailing, connects seamlessly to the 30-storey tower added in 1994. Inside, soaring ceilings, marble colonnades, and a live string quartet create an atmosphere that transcends time. Every space exudes restraint and craftsmanship, a quiet luxury that appeals to the world’s most discerning guests.
Accommodation and Design
The hotel offers 300 rooms and suites spanning 12 catergories, each crafted for privacy, comfort, and harmony. The interiors balance heritage and technology — from handcrafted wood furnishings and rich textiles to concealed automation systems.
The Peninsula Suite, the pinnacle of accommodation, includes a private gym, grand piano, and panoramic harbour views. The Marco Polo Suite, inspired by the spirit of travel, evokes cultural sophistication with bespoke décor and curated art. Even the Grand Deluxe Harbour View Rooms reflect an attention to detail found in few hotels worldwide, offering serenity above the vibrant skyline.

Dining and Culinary Heritage
With eight bars and restaurants, The Peninsula defines the city’s fine dining scene:
- Gaddi’s – A French institution since 1953, known for haute cuisine and orchestral dining.
- Spring Moon – A Michelin-starred Cantonese restaurant blending authenticity with artistry.
- Felix – Designed by Philippe Starck, offering avant-garde dining with sweeping skyline views.
- The Lobby – Home of the world-famous Afternoon Tea, a Hong Kong tradition since the 1930s.
Each venue tells a story of craftsmanship and heritage. Ingredients are sourced from sustainable producers, techniques honour both East and West, and service remains meticulously choreographed.

Arrival and Transport
The hotel’s fleet of 14 Rolls-Royce Phantoms is legendary, representing the largest single order in the company’s history. Chauffeurs meet guests airside, ensuring seamless airport transfers. The private helipad allows direct arrivals from Hong Kong International Airport or nearby cities, eliminating travel time while maintaining privacy.
From the moment of arrival, luggage, customs, and coordination are handled silently — ensuring a transition so smooth it feels choreographed.
